Output 9499cc6386d9d771c6defb30fd8a0ef96b79f11d6571bd0772405184d3434585:1

value
52529955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b573594ed9d13b16df5c5ff62712723d57f56a OP_EQUAL
address
3DRZnWGfER37PLBrdaiKWGxEkv3ezLemCY
transaction
9499cc6386d9d771c6defb30fd8a0ef96b79f11d6571bd0772405184d3434585
spent
true